CLEVELAND — Former Cleveland Chief City Planner Kimberly Scott was arraigned on felony theft charges on Friday morning.
A judge issued a personal bond for her.
A pretrial hearing has been set for Oct. 15.

She has been placed on administrative leave without pay.
The alleged victim in this case is Farid Abdul Malik, who passed away in June 2025.
